## AddrSnap Widget — Data Stores

The AddrSnap autocomplete widget reads from two stores: a Redis cache for prefix lookups and the Gazetteer Postgres instance for canonical addresses. Cache misses fall through to Postgres directly, so latency spikes usually mean cache eviction churn. Restart the warmer job before touching anything else. For direct queries, connect using the following string.

warehouse DSN: mssql://rusdor_svc:0FSWCn9@db-951a.paliqforge.local:5432/ulawyn

Internal Memo — Reseller Programme Update

To all branch managers of Quillstone Trading. The reseller programme relaunches next quarter under the name Partner Ridge. Tiered margins replace flat discounts; onboarding packs go out Monday. Each branch must nominate two candidate resellers by the 15th — no exceptions. Existing agreements run unchanged until renewal. Questions go through your regional lead. The confidential note covering the related business plans appears directly below.

internal memo for yahag-tahog: The pricing group signed off on a budget of $152.8 million for Project Soriel.

Cut-over done. Canary gating on Pinwheel deploys now runs through the Halden rule engine instead of the old shell checks. Gates evaluate error rate, p95 latency, and saturation over a five-minute window; any breach auto-rolls back. Manual overrides are logged and page you. If a rollback fires tonight, don't fight it. Current gating configuration is as follows.

service settings:
novath:
  pin: 1396
  tenant: pelys
  seal: seal_ccc035e1
  metrics_host: metrics.novath.qorvelworks.test
  standby_team: fraeth
  escalation: drueth-zorok
  nonce: 61d508